Indo Pacific 2022: Australia begins trials of Oceanwatch payload on S-100 UAVs

by Ridzwan Rahmat

A mock-up of the S-100 Camcopter, seen at Indo Pacific 2022 with the PT-8N Oceanwatch sensor (forward) and the MX-10 electro-optical turret. (Janes/Ridzwan Rahmat)

The Royal Australian Navy (RAN) has equipped its S-100 Camcopter rotor-wing unmanned aerial vehicles (UAVs) with the PT-8 Oceanwatch sensor payload.

A representative from the RAN's 822X Squadron who spoke to Janes at the Indo Pacific 2022 exhibition in Sydney confirmed that the payload has been mounted in addition to the UAV's existing Wescam MX-10 electro-optical infrared turret.

The PT-8 Oceanwatch is an optical-based passive radar system that autonomously detects anomalies between consecutive images captured. Should there be an anomaly, the operator would be alerted by the Oceanwatch system who can subsequently activate the MX-10 sensors for further verifications on whether it is indeed an object of interest, said the 822X Squadron representative.

The S-100 Camcopter's manufacturer, Schiebel, first disclosed in 2018 that it had successfully integrated the PT-8 Oceanwatch system on the UAVs. Further verifications by Janes with industry sources at Indo Pacific 2022 confirm that the variant that has been mounted on the RAN's S-100s is the PT-8N, which has been optimised for night-time operations.

Brazil to update A-29 Super Tucano aircraft fleet

by Victor Barreira

A Brazilian Air Force Embraer EMB 314 Super Tucano light attack/counter-insurgency aircraft. The details of Brazil's fleet upgrade are as yet undisclosed. (Janes/Gareth Jennings)

Embraer Defense and Security is to carry out the mid-life upgrade (MLU) of 68 of the EMB 314 (locally designated A-29) Super Tucano training and light attack aircraft of the Brazilian Air Force, the service's commander Lieutenant Brigadier Marcelo Kanitz Damasceno said on 17 April during a presentation to the Brazilian Committee on Foreign Relations and National Defense.

The MLU is intended to extend the lifespan of the aircraft by up to 25 years, Lt Brig Damasceno said, and follows a June 2023 agreement between Embraer and the Brazilian Air Force to study a technological refresh of the Super Tucanos, although details were not disclosed.

Brazil purchased 25 A-29A and 51 A-29B aircraft in 2001, adding eight A-29As and 15 A-29Bs in 2005. The fleet was received between 2003 and 2012.

Airbus flies RACER high-speed helicopter

by Gareth Jennings

The RACER high-speed helicopter departed Marignane on its maiden flight on 25 April. (Airbus)

Airbus Helicopters has flown its Rapid and Cost-Efficient Rotorcraft (RACER) concept for the first time, the company announced on 25 April.

The milestone took place at Airbus Helicopters' Marignane production facility in southern France, with the maiden flight lasting for approximately 30 minutes during which the aircraft's flight characteristics were assessed.

“This important milestone launches the flight campaign, which will take two years and will aim to progressively open the aircraft's flight envelope and demonstrate its high-speed capabilities,” Airbus said.

First revealed at the Paris Air Show in 2017, the RACER is geared towards providing the best trade-off between speed, cost-efficiency, sustainability, and mission performance. The concept has a stated goal of a cruise speed of more than 400 km/h (250 mph).

QinetiQ demonstrates jet-to-jet MUM-T for first time in the UK

by Gareth Jennings

An artist's impression of a demonstration announced on 25 April, in which QinetiQ for the first time in the UK demonstrated MUM-T between jet aircraft. (QinetiQ)

QinetiQ has for the first time in the UK demonstrated manned-unmanned teaming (MUM-T) between jet aircraft.

Announced by the company on 25 April, the demonstration at the Ministry of Defence (MoD) Boscombe Down site in southern England saw a manned BAe 146 testbed aircraft provide inflight tasking to a modified unmanned Banshee Jet 80 target drone.

“The success of this trial demonstrates that the combination of [MUM-T] between current front-line combat aircraft and next-generation drones can be potentially achieved successfully with the existing combat air fleet, while offering the potential to increase combat capability in an affordable manner,” QinetiQ said, adding that the mission was completed not only by the live Banshee but also a number of digital Banshees within a live-virtual swarm.

For the demonstration, the Banshee was equipped with QinetiQ's Airborne Command and Control for Swarm Interoperable Missions (ACCSIOM) technology, which, the company said, enabled the drone to communicate with the manned aircraft using the same messaging format as the standard NATO Link 16 datalink.
